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2006.06.11;
Скачать: CL | DM;

Вниз

Эх, глюки   Найти похожие ветки 

 
Marser ©   (2006-05-14 00:25) [40]

> [39] Lamer@fools.ua ©   (14.05.06 00:09)
> > Never attribute to malice which can be adequately explained
> by stupidity.
> +
>
> Бритва Хеллона:
> Не усматривайте злого умысла в том, что вполне объяснимо
> глупостью.
>
> Почему "+", если это просто перевод? :-)

Тоже хотел спросить :-)


 
KilkennyCat ©   (2006-05-14 21:13) [41]


> if (flag == true) and
>   (flag == true) and
>   (flag == true) and
>   (flag == true) and
>   (flag == true) and
>   (flag == true) and
>   (flag == true) then
>  Result := true
> else
>  Result := false


руки просто чешутся...

Result := (flag == true) and
  (flag == true) and
  (flag == true) and
  (flag == true) and
  (flag == true) and
  (flag == true) and
  (flag == true);


 
Lamer@fools.ua ©   (2006-05-14 21:46) [42]

Лично у меня руки чешутся двойной символ "=" на одиночный заменить.


 
Gero_   (2006-05-14 23:55) [43]


> AlexanderMS ©   (13.05.06 19:01) 

Если будет продемонстирован код, вызывающий глюки, тогда можно будет о чем-то говорить.


 
Imbac   (2006-05-15 00:26) [44]

1:
if a=b then
begin
  if b=a then
  begin
       if a<>b then
        begin
            if a<=b then
            begin
                 if b>=a then
                begin
                end
                else
                begin
                     goto 1;//Вдруг компилятор ошибся
                end;
            end;
        end;
  end;
end;


 
Imbac   (2006-05-15 00:27) [45]

:DDD


 
Джо ©   (2006-05-15 01:17) [46]

> goto 1

Это вам не Бейсик, батенька! ;)


 
Marser ©   (2006-05-15 01:30) [47]

Дадад, label должон соответствовать правилам составления имён идентификаторов...


 
KilkennyCat ©   (2006-05-15 02:46) [48]

Оптимизируем дальше:

Result := flag and flag and flag and flag and flag and flag and flag;


 
Джо ©   (2006-05-15 02:48) [49]

> [48] KilkennyCat ©   (15.05.06 02:46)
> Оптимизируем дальше:
>
> Result := flag and flag and flag and flag and flag and flag
> and flag;

Небезопасно. Эх, учи вас :)

try
 Result := flag and flag and flag and flag and flag and flag
finally
 // может, в этот раз повезёт?
 Result := flag and flag and flag and flag and flag and flag
end;


 
Германн ©   (2006-05-15 03:06) [50]

2 Джо ©   (15.05.06 02:48) [49]
except забыл вставить, имхо. :-)


 
Джо ©   (2006-05-15 03:07) [51]

> [50] Германн ©   (15.05.06 03:06)
> 2 Джо ©   (15.05.06 02:48) [49]
> except забыл вставить, имхо. :-)

Это можно. Даже двойной блок. На всякий пожарный :-)


 
TStas ©   (2006-05-18 23:14) [52]

Один раз Дельфи скомпилировали недоступное окно. Еще раз нажал кнопку - скомпилировали доступное. Других глюков не видел. Бывало, что при закрытии дельфей вылезали окошки с сообщением о какой-то ошибке, но глюк это дельфей или виндов не знаю


 
API ©   (2006-05-18 23:25) [53]

но глюк это дельфей или виндов не знаю

Мне так думается, что в 99% случаев это глюк разработчика, написавшего компонент.



Страницы: 1 2 вся ветка

Текущий архив: 2006.06.11;
Скачать: CL | DM;

Наверх




Память: 0.56 MB
Время: 0.062 c
4-1142495715
Вопрос2006
2006-03-16 10:55
2006.06.11
GetWindowPlacement


15-1147336189
Marser
2006-05-11 12:29
2006.06.11
Могли бы Вы стать гуманитарием?


1-1146730752
SergeyG
2006-05-04 12:19
2006.06.11
При сохранении графического файла в формате .jpg


1-1146951293
Германн
2006-05-07 01:34
2006.06.11
String, PChar и {$H+}/{$H-}


2-1148557512
v eb
2006-05-25 15:45
2006.06.11
Прервать соединение